Transaction 80f08489373541ca5747dac3ead75b742cc8ca8044682c1d274a30854c712828
1 Input
2 Outputs
- 80f08489373541ca5747dac3ead75b742cc8ca8044682c1d274a30854c712828:0
- 80f08489373541ca5747dac3ead75b742cc8ca8044682c1d274a30854c712828:1
value 27129
address 3AVErAp1Ctu34WpWsGyp9vjY4oFpevCV9E
value 206968
address 12kNVpjRPMLuRk8WxW6ahpkzb4vETFTacC